Why It's Crucial to Storm-Proof Your Roof

Severe weather events, such as thunderstorms, hurricanes, and tornadoes, can wreak havoc on your home. As the most exposed part of your property, your roof bears the brunt of storm damage. Ensuring your roof is storm-resistant is crucial for protecting your property and loved ones. With the right roofing upgrades, you can greatly increase your roof's ability to withstand harsh weather conditions and extend its lifespan.

Must-Have Roofing Upgrades for Storm Resistance

  • 1. Impact-Resistant Roofing Materials

    One of the most effective ways to storm-proof your roof is by choosing impact-resistant materials. Materials like metal, slate, and specially engineered asphalt shingles are more resistant to high winds and flying debris compared to traditional shingles. These materials are specifically engineered to resist punctures and damage during severe weather conditions.

  • 2. Reinforced Roof Decking

    The deck beneath your roofing materials plays a critical role in the roof’s strength. Reinforcing your roof deck with durable materials ensures it can withstand powerful winds. Secure decking is vital to prevent your roof from being lifted during storms, a leading cause of roof damage.

  • 3. Upgraded Flashing and Sealant

    Flashing is designed to protect your roof’s vulnerable areas—such as around chimneys, vents, and valleys—from water infiltration. Upgrading to high-quality flashing and sealant prevents water from seeping into your home, especially during heavy rain or wind-driven storms. For greater durability, choose flashing made from copper or aluminum.

  • 4. Wind-Resistant Roofing Installation

    Proper installation is key to ensuring your roof holds up under wind pressure. A professional contractor should install your roof using proper fasteners and techniques to ensure wind resistance. Hurricane clips and metal straps can be used to secure your roof, greatly enhancing its wind resistance.

  • 5. Gutter and Downspout Maintenance

    Gutters and downspouts play a crucial role in channeling rainwater away from your roof and home. Clogged gutters can cause water to back up, leading to leaks and potential roof damage. Regularly maintaining your gutters and ensuring that they’re properly secured to the roof can prevent damage during heavy storms.

How to Choose the Right Roofing Contractor for Storm-Proofing

When considering storm-proofing upgrades, it’s essential to hire a trusted and experienced roofing contractor. Look for companies that specialize in storm-resistant roofs and have experience working with impact-resistant materials. Additionally, ensure that they are licensed, insured, and familiar with local building codes that may require specific storm-proofing standards.
